编程,这个曾经看似遥不可及的技能,如今正逐渐走进我们的生活。无论是为了职业发展,还是出于个人兴趣,学会编程都变得越来越重要。那么,如何从零开始,轻松学会手动编程呢?本文将为你提供一份新手必看的教学攻略,并附上实用案例解析,让你轻松入门。
第一部分:编程基础知识
1. 编程语言的选择
首先,你需要选择一门适合初学者的编程语言。以下是一些适合新手的编程语言:
- Python:语法简洁,易于学习,适合初学者。
- Java:应用广泛,适合开发大型项目。
- C++:性能强大,适合学习计算机科学。
2. 编程环境搭建
选择好编程语言后,你需要搭建一个编程环境。以下是一些常用的编程工具:
- 集成开发环境(IDE):如PyCharm、Eclipse、Visual Studio等。
- 代码编辑器:如VS Code、Sublime Text等。
3. 编程基础语法
学习编程语言的基础语法是入门的关键。以下是一些常见的编程基础语法:
- 变量:用于存储数据。
- 数据类型:如整数、浮点数、字符串等。
- 运算符:如加、减、乘、除等。
- 控制结构:如循环、条件语句等。
第二部分:编程实践
1. 编写第一个程序
编写第一个程序是学习编程的重要一步。以下是一个简单的Python程序示例:
print("Hello, World!")
这段代码将在屏幕上输出“Hello, World!”。
2. 实用案例解析
以下是一些实用的编程案例,帮助你巩固所学知识:
- 计算器程序:实现加减乘除运算。
- 猜数字游戏:用户输入一个数字,程序随机生成一个数字,用户猜测,直到猜中为止。
- 数据排序:对一组数据进行排序。
第三部分:进阶学习
1. 学习算法和数据结构
算法和数据结构是编程的核心。以下是一些常用的算法和数据结构:
- 排序算法:如冒泡排序、快速排序等。
- 数据结构:如数组、链表、栈、队列等。
2. 学习面向对象编程
面向对象编程(OOP)是一种编程范式,它将数据和行为封装在一起。以下是一些OOP的基本概念:
- 类:用于创建对象。
- 对象:类的实例。
- 继承:子类继承父类的属性和方法。
- 多态:同一操作作用于不同的对象,可以有不同的解释。
总结
通过以上教学攻略和实用案例解析,相信你已经对手动编程有了初步的了解。记住,编程是一门实践性很强的技能,只有不断练习,才能不断提高。祝你学习愉快!
